What Is Selenium Testing?
Selenium is an open-source automation testing tool used to validate web applications across different browsers and platforms. It supports multiple programming languages like Java, Python, C#, and JavaScript.
Selenium is not a single tool but a suite consisting of:
Selenium IDE (Integrated Development Environment)
Selenium WebDriver
Selenium Grid
Selenium RC (now deprecated)
This flexibility and versatility have made it a staple in test automation frameworks across the globe.

Understanding Selenium: Selenium is a powerful tool used for automating web browser interactions. It comprises various components, with Selenium WebDriver being the core for browser automation. Essentially, Selenium enables testers to mimic user actions on websites programmatically.
Advanced Automation Techniques:
Streamline with Page Object Model (POM): Adopting the Page Object Model facilitates organizing test code into reusable components, enhancing maintainability and readability. Each component corresponds to a web page, encapsulating its elements and interactions.
Enhance Testing with Data-Driven Approaches: Data-driven testing empowers testers to execute test cases with multiple datasets, validating application behavior under diverse scenarios. By integrating external data sources, such as Excel sheets or databases, testers can parameterize test data and execute tests efficiently.
Optimize Testing with TestNG: TestNG integration enriches Selenium testing capabilities, offering features like parallel execution, parameterization, and comprehensive reporting. Leveraging TestNG annotations enables effective test management and execution control.
Ensure Compatibility with Cross-Browser Testing: Cross-browser testing is essential to ensure consistent performance across different web browsers. Selenium's compatibility with various browsers, coupled with cloud-based testing platforms, facilitates comprehensive cross-browser testing.
Precision with Advanced Locators: Mastering advanced locator strategies enhances the reliability and efficiency of test scripts. Techniques such as dynamic XPath and CSS selector optimization enable precise element identification, ensuring robust test execution.
Adapt to Dynamic Elements: Selenium provides mechanisms to handle dynamic elements encountered during testing. Techniques like implicit and explicit waits, along with dynamic element identification strategies, ensure stable test execution in dynamic application environments.

What is Selenium?
Selenium is an open-source framework used for automating web browsers. It allows users to write test scripts to automate interactions with web applications, ensuring that the application functions correctly and meets user expectations. By automating repetitive testing tasks, Selenium helps save time and improve the reliability of tests.
Key Concepts of Selenium
1. Test Automation Test automation refers to the process of using software tools to perform tests on an application automatically. Instead of manually executing test cases, testers write scripts to simulate user actions and check if the application behaves as expected.
2. Web Browser Automation Selenium is specifically designed to automate web browsers. It interacts with browsers to test the UI (user interface) and functional aspects of web applications. Selenium allows testers to automate tasks such as clicking buttons, filling out forms, navigating between pages, and verifying elements.
3. Scripting Languages One of Selenium’s core strengths is that it supports multiple programming languages, including Java, Python, C#, Ruby, and JavaScript. This makes it a versatile tool, catering to teams with different technical skills.
Selenium Components
Selenium is composed of several components that together enable web automation testing:
1. Selenium WebDriver WebDriver is the most essential component of Selenium. It provides an interface for writing test scripts in various programming languages. WebDriver interacts directly with the browser and provides a more robust, real-time testing experience compared to its predecessor, Selenium RC. It is responsible for executing actions like navigating a website, interacting with elements, and retrieving test results.
2. Selenium IDE (Integrated Development Environment) Selenium IDE is a simple tool used for recording and playing back tests. It is a browser extension available for Firefox and Chrome, allowing testers to record their interactions with the web browser and automatically generate test scripts. Selenium IDE is ideal for beginners because it doesn’t require coding skills, but its functionality is more limited compared to WebDriver.
3. Selenium Grid Selenium Grid allows users to run tests across multiple machines and browsers simultaneously. It helps distribute the load of testing across different systems, improving the speed and efficiency of automated tests. Selenium Grid is particularly useful for large projects where you need to test on different browsers, operating systems, and versions simultaneously.
4. Selenium Remote Control (RC) Selenium RC was one of the earlier components of Selenium used for automation. However, it has been largely replaced by WebDriver, which offers more stability and flexibility. Selenium RC requires a server to be started before executing tests and operates with a proxy server to communicate with the web browser. Although it is outdated, it is still useful for legacy systems and can be found in some older test suites.

Why Selenium is So Popular
1. Cross-Browser Compatibility Selenium supports a wide variety of browsers, including Google Chrome, Mozilla Firefox, Safari, and Internet Explorer. This cross-browser compatibility allows testers to ensure that web applications perform consistently across different platforms.
2. Open Source Being an open-source tool, Selenium is free to use, making it accessible for individual testers, startups, and enterprises alike. It also has an active open-source community that continuously contributes to its improvement.
3. Language Flexibility Selenium supports several programming languages, including Java, Python, C#, Ruby, and JavaScript, which allows teams to use their preferred language to write tests.
4. Integration with Other Tools Selenium integrates well with other tools such as Jenkins for continuous integration, TestNG and JUnit for test execution and reporting, and Maven for project management. This integration helps automate the entire testing pipeline.
Getting Started with Selenium
1. Choose a Programming Language To start using Selenium, you’ll need to choose a programming language you're comfortable with. Java and Python are the most commonly used languages in Selenium, but Selenium supports multiple languages, so the choice depends on your team’s expertise.
2. Install WebDriver Once you’ve chosen a language, the next step is to install Selenium WebDriver and the browser drivers (such as ChromeDriver for Google Chrome or GeckoDriver for Firefox). These drivers allow Selenium to communicate with the browsers.
3. Write Test Scripts Begin by writing simple test scripts to automate basic tasks like navigating to a website, clicking buttons, and verifying page elements. As you gain confidence, you can create more complex test cases that simulate real user behavior.
4. Use Selenium with Testing Frameworks For better organization and reporting, integrate Selenium with testing frameworks like TestNG, JUnit, or PyTest. These frameworks allow you to execute, manage, and report test results in a more structured manner.
